Definitions
A form of inconspicuous or subdued luxury, often by lesser-known brands.
Examples
“Perhaps I would mind⟳ this “quiet luxury” less if the clothes were fabulous. But, instead, they’re bloodless, grandly bland, dreary.”
““Quiet luxury” is a kabuki performance of moneyed ease and indifference.”
“There was also an ostentatiously open-top boat ride⟳ down the Seine, where I think⟳ the ladies went to view⟳ the floating corpse of a trend once known as “quiet luxury”.”
